STANLEY - born on 09.09.2018, shoulder height 29 cm, 7.5 kg Stanley is a very nice guy who has really started to experience life since he has been at the animal shelter. The first few days were really tough for him, but we see progress every day! Gradually, he is becoming more attached and friendly. He has never been aggressive, but like almost all the dogs rescued here, he had no contact with people. It took some time for him to gain trust. Stanley is one of 15 dogs that were rescued from a desperate situation. His previous owner suffered from "Noah's Syndrome" - a mental disorder in which animals are pathologically accumulated in a household. The animals were originally taken in from the streets with good intentions, but the number of animals grew too fast to provide proper care for them all. In his previous home, the dogs did not go for walks, they did not know a leash, and they initially did not let people touch them. Only after the owner's death did the neighbors become aware of the difficult situation. Currently, Stanley is still in the socialization and adaptation phase of a new life. 🇩🇪Adopting from Germany

German rescues typically require an in-person home visit (Vorkontrolle) or detailed video home check before approving adoption. Animals leave the shelter sterilized, microchipped, and with a valid EU pet passport. Adoption fees usually fall between €250 and €450, covering veterinary preparation.

Can I adopt Stanley if I live in another country?
Yes, in most cases. Rescues across Europe routinely place animals abroad — Hunde ohne Heimat e.V. will tell you what they need (EU pet passport, rabies titer, transport coordination) and whether they handle transport themselves or refer you to a partner. Plan for an extra €100–€350 in transport costs depending on distance.
